KU GSIS has revised some of provisions regarding the selection for scholarship of international students, minimum eligibility requirements, and selection priority for students of the same rank.
This bylaw will be applied from 2019 Fall Semester Scholarship.


Selection


Selection will be made by the Committee of Graduate School of International Studies among those who satisfy the minimum qualification requirements each semester.


Minimum Qualification


A) Students must complete at least 9 credits of courses except foreign language classes and internships in the previous semester, and receive an CGPA(Cumulated Grade Points Average) of 4.0 or higher;
B) Students must keep enrolled;
C) In order to receive scholarship for the third semester, students must complete at least 18 credits in total and take all the core and core elective courses except for “Thesis Research Ⅰ“ by the second semester. If a student does not satisfy the above requirements, he or she will not be eligible for the scholarship not only for the third semester but also for the fourth semester.
(Clause C will begin to be in effect from the 2020 Spring Semester Scholarship Scheme.)


Selection Priority for Students of the Same Rank


The selection is made according to the following requirements.(priority given from A to C) if there are students of the same rank.

A) Those who acquired more credits in the previous semester;
B) Those who acquired more credits in core and core elective courses;
C) Those who have more total credits.

However, if the priority cannot be determined, it is decided by the Chair of the Committee of Graduate School of International Studies.

 

※ The selection process and decision for scholarship recipients in this semester will not reflect all the changes in the revision of bylaw. We do not consider the common course requirements among the minimum qualification requirements. This means that Clause C will begin to be in effect from the 2020 Spring Semester Scholarship Scheme. We are also going to select all students of the same rank this time without considering the clause of selection priority.
